Essential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
Ground Beef: Use lean ground beef for a healthier option without compromising on flavor.
Taco Seasoning: Store-bought or homemade; either works wonders to elevate the flavor.
Tortillas: Choose sturdy flour tortillas to hold all those tasty layers together.
Refried Beans: Canned refried beans save time and give a creamy texture.
Shredded Cheese: A mix of cheddar and Monterey Jack melts beautifully over the top.
Sliced Jalapeños: Add spice according to your heat preference; fresh or pickled work well!
Tomato Sauce: A simple sauce brings moisture and tanginess to balance the richness.
Chopped Green Onions: Fresh green onions add crunch and color as a garnish.
Sour Cream (optional): A dollop of sour cream adds creaminess that complements every bite.

Let’s Make it Together
Prepare Your Base: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). While it heats up, grab two large baking sheets and lay out your tortillas flat.
Cook the Ground Beef: In a skillet over medium heat, cook the ground beef until browned. Stir in taco seasoning until well combined, allowing those enticing aromas to fill your kitchen.
Add Refried Beans: Spread a generous layer of refried beans over each tortilla. The creamy texture forms a delicious barrier between crispy tortilla and savory toppings.
Layer It Up: Spoon some seasoned ground beef over the beans followed by half of your shredded cheese. Now’s the time to sprinkle those sliced jalapeños if you dare!
Bake Until Golden: Place your assembled pizzas in the oven and bake for about 10-12 minutes until everything is bubbly and golden brown. Your kitchen will smell heavenly by now!
Add Final Touches: Once baked, remove from the oven and drizzle with tomato sauce. Top with remaining cheese and sprinkle chopped green onions on top before serving hot.

Storing & Reheating
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Reheat in the oven at 350°F for about 10 minutes to retain crispiness.
Chef's Helpful Tips
- Use cornmeal on your baking sheet for added crunch when making the crust
- Avoid overloading toppings to ensure even cooking
- Let it cool slightly before slicing to maintain shape and prevent toppings from sliding off

Ingredients
- 1 lb lean ground beef
- 2 tbsp taco seasoning
- 4 large flour tortillas
- 1 cup canned refried beans
- 2 cups shredded cheddar and Monterey Jack cheese blend
- 1/2 cup sliced jalapeños (fresh or pickled)
- 1/2 cup tomato sauce
- 1/4 cup chopped green onions
- 1/4 cup sour cream (optional)
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).
- On two large baking sheets, lay out the tortillas.
- In a skillet over medium heat, cook ground beef until browned; mix in taco seasoning.
- Spread refried beans evenly over each tortilla.
- Layer seasoned ground beef and half the shredded cheese on top of the beans. Add jalapeños if desired.
- Bake for 10-12 minutes until bubbly and golden brown.
- Drizzle with tomato sauce, add remaining cheese, and sprinkle green onions before serving.
